Hardware companies typically ‘ve got aboard that have ALUA however, you can find hold-outs
However I’m kinda speaking ancient background… plus my personal hopes of now distant operating systems including Windows NT weren’t you to definitely high. However, I happened to be still astonished initially I exhibited a good SAN LUN that had 4 pathways…. and you may Screen NT declared they had discover five disks in place of one to (then tried to produce a trademark toward them!). Unfortunately AIX was not better (this was inside the time of AIX 4.2/4.3). Such Operating systems insisted into watching for each and every highway because a separate LUN…. that was a while clueless. They became rapidly apparent that a couple of things were happening:
- Almost any SCSI criteria resided to make certain uniform actions anywhere between resources and you will app manufacturers, just weren’t getting welcomed.
- Seller book multiple-pathing approaches to do these routes became routine practice.
For IBM this meant creating an item of software called Study Path Optimiser or DPO. IBM toyed to your thought of charging you for it, however, quickly realised you to definitely performing this generated no feel, so they really renamed it Subsystem Device Driver (SDD) and made they readily available no-cost. Other manufacturers came out employing own sizes for their own apparatus (envision EMC PowerPath or Hitachi HDLM) when you find yourself Veritas introduced a multi-merchant able to plan called DMP (hence made way more feel, but cost currency and thus didn’t have this new triumph they deserved).
- Operating systems dealers necessary to embrace multi-pathing just like the an indigenous element of your own items.
- Knowledge manufacturers wanted to incorporate SCSI fundamental certified means of indicating just how numerous routes is presented and used by those working options.
IBM already been which have a fix level when you look at the AIX 5
Thank goodness in the two cases, some typically common feel began to emerge from new fog. Operating systems providers extra local MPIO capability. Microsoft come providing big inside Windows 2003 (that have MPIO) and Atlanta GA backpage escort much more so in Window 2008. dos (and that additional MPIO), Sunrays banged from inside the with MPxIO. Linux added DMP, that was good step because protected IBM out of having so you can recompile it is signed-provider SDD plan whenever yet another Linux kernel made an appearance.
On methods front SCSI3 criteria developed ALUA (Asynchronous Logical Device Availableness). Essentially ALUA lets an effective strorage tool to indicate in order to an operating-system and therefore routes are prominent, to your both a port by the port base and you may an amount by volume foundation. This is really important to possess shops products which was energetic/inactive, sometimes having a complete control or into the a quantity from the regularity basis (elizabeth.grams. showing that Frequency 1 will be if at all possible simply be accessed having fun with slots into the Operator Some time Regularity dos would be to preferably only be reached using slots on the Controller B).
Therefore, the story gets better as time goes on. Due to this fact I found myself very happy to notice that the new DS3500 and you can DCS3700 of IBM usually today assistance ALUA (shortly after an excellent firmware upgrade so you can type or later on, which should be available ). The fresh announcement letter is here. It is a great step of progress. In case you’re wanting to know, IBMs DS8000, XIV, Storwize V7000 and you can SVC all assistance ALUA.
But unfortuitously although this improve is a good positive step of progress for IBM, there are still certain simple trouble in the market that need getting repaired. Firstly: Dealers need end promoting their particular multi-pathing application and sometimes heed merely plugins in order to Operating system application (such as for instance DSMs getting Windows otherwise PCMs to possess AIX, possibly with a few handy tools so you’re able to record path status) otherwise preferably work on native MPIO “from the box”. It indicates for-instance altering away from SDD so you’re able to SDDDSM (Windows) or SDD to SDDPCM (AIX). Ideally also these plugins should become redundant.